German national team release first list of 27 players for Euro.

German national team Euro 2024 host nation announces tentative 27-player squad for this summer’s tournament Julian Nagelsmann’s team entered the tournament with high expectations as the host football nation. But have had an up-and-down run of form in recent times.

In the last major tournament in the 2022 World Cup, they were eliminated in the group stage. But they have shown improvement under the control of the 36-year-old coach. Recently defeating both France and the Netherlands. German national team

Several key players from the latest squad were also left out by Nagelsmann, who announced the squad at a press conference in Berlin.

Mats Hummels, who was a key player in taking Dortmund to the Champions League final. There is no name in this team.

He last won 78 caps for his country in November. But at the age of 35, his international career appears to be over.

In the midfield there is no Leon Goretzka from Bayern Munich. While Manchester City hero goalkeeper Stefan Ortega, who has never been called up to the national team has also been rejected.

One of the Premier League players included is Kai Havertz, who enjoyed a successful first season at Arsenal after joining from Chelsea.

He joins the likes of Thomas Muller and Max Beyer as strikers, with Deniz Undaf from Brighton, who is on loan at Stuttgart, also attached Team too.

Another player in the English top flight is Pascal Gross, who has been in excellent form for Brighton this season.

One more player will be removed from the 27-man squad, with teams competing in the final Euros allowed 26 players.
